Stromgarde Keep

Stromgarde Keep is located in the Arathi Highlands. It is actively patrolled by the Grin's number one enemy, the Keepers of Stromgarde. The Keepers are charged with maintaining the Keep free of all Horde as well as clearing out members of the Syndicate who have taken up residence inside. The Grin has makes occasional raids into the Keep to strike fear into the hearts of the Alliance (see the Battle for Stromgarde Keep).
Geography, Layout, and Weaknesses
The Keep sits on a hill overlooking two lakes to the front and cliffs at the rear. The main road runs east to west in front of the Keep with a T-section turning south heading directly into the Keep. To the immediate north of the T-section is a large hill overlooking the road.
There are two possible entrances for Horde forces to use in battle. The first is the main entrance to the Keep which lies at the end of a long causeway. Lakes lie to either side of this causeway.
The second entrance is a crack in the wall which lies to the southeast of the main gates. This crack is usually guarded by the Keepers but it's proximity to Prince Trollbane's throneroom and the bridge overlooking the main entrance have been used effectively by Grin forces in the past.
